如何将java程序打包发送

如何将java程序打包发送

作者:William Gu发布时间:2026-02-13阅读时长:0 分钟阅读次数:6

用户关注问题

Q
如何将Java程序打包成可执行文件?

我有一个Java项目,想要打包成方便运行的文件形式,应该如何操作?

A

使用JAR文件打包Java程序的方法

Java程序通常打包成JAR文件,这是一种包含编译后字节码和相关资源的归档文件。可以使用命令行的jar工具或者集成开发环境(如Eclipse、IntelliJ IDEA)来创建JAR包。确保在清单文件中指定主类,这样运行时可以直接启动程序。

Q
Java程序打包后如何发送给其他人运行?

我已经将Java程序打包成JAR文件,怎样安全且方便地发送给同事或者客户?

A

建议的Java程序发送方式

可以通过电子邮件、云存储服务(如Google Drive、Dropbox)或者代码托管平台来分享JAR文件。发送时明确告知运行环境需求,比如Java版本要求,方便接收者顺利执行程序。

Q
Java程序打包时需要注意哪些文件和依赖?

在进行Java程序打包时,应该考虑哪些附加内容确保程序能正常运行?

A

打包过程中必须管理的文件和依赖项

除了.class文件,还要包含程序依赖的第三方库。可以采用“fat JAR”(或者称为uber JAR)的方式将所有依赖打包进一个文件。若项目使用构建工具(如Maven或Gradle),可借助它们自动处理依赖和打包过程。